Key Workforce Metrics

Timbarra P-9 College has 86 staff members (68.0 FTE), including 57 teachers and 29 non-teaching staff.

Staffing Ratio Comparison

How Timbarra P-9 College's student-to-teacher ratio compares to state and national averages. A lower ratio generally means more individual attention per student.

Timbarra P-9
11.7:1
VIC Average
11.7:1
National Average
12.3:1

With a ratio of 11.7:1, this school has a better student-to-teacher ratio than both the VIC average (11.7:1) and the national average (12.3:1).
